Iran admits it lost contact with a drone after the US shot one down.

Iran has acknowledged that it has lost communication with a Shahed-129 drone in international waters, after completing its task of gathering information on military activities near the Islamic Republic, and following the announcement from the United States about the destruction of an Iranian drone. The Tasnim agency reported that a drone from the Revolutionary Guard managed to send information back to its base, but communication was subsequently interrupted. According to this source, the Shahed-129 drone was conducting reconnaissance and surveillance of international waters, and the reason behind the device’s disconnection is currently under investigation. The Fars agency noted that the drone’s objective was to monitor military activities in the waters near the Islamic Republic and transmit the information to its base on land.
